+2 Rating Rate Down Rate Up Canobie Coaster on 7/26/2005 6:04:00 PM
Thunder Rapids Raft Ride is a nationally recognized river rapids ride (seen on Discovery Channels Extreme Rides). Despite all the fame and attention, I have honestly been on much better river rapids rides. There are many green rafts which creates a high capacity. The layout is better than many other river rapids rides I have been on because it has many rapids that get you wet, a final rapid that soaks riders, and a waterfall (though poor it adds variety to the ride). The rides surroundings near the mountain is very nice. You get the wettest on the last rapid sending a large cascade of water over the lucky riders who plunge into it. No matter where you sit on this ride you will come off wet. Luckily, I have never encountered a wait on this ride. It has always been a walk-on for me because I generally ride it around 6:30 when few people want to get wet. Overall, a fun river rapids ride.
